How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lone Tree?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lone Tree Studio Apartments | $1,143 | $780 | $1,495 |
| Lone Tree 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,244 | $800 | $2,019 |
| Lone Tree 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,345 | $695 | $2,400 |
| Lone Tree 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,204 | $695 | $3,300 |
| Lone Tree 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,501 | $699 | $2,730 |

Largest Available Lone Tree and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Lone Tree, IA is found at Riverfront Crossings in the Fair Meadows neighborhood and is 2,004 square feet priced from $3,300. The Quarters Iowa City has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,580 square feet and currently listed start at $725.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in Lone Tree: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Riverfront Crossings | 3BR | 2,004 Sq Ft | $3,300 |
| The Quarters Iowa City | E1 - 3x3 | 1,580 Sq Ft | $725 |
| The Hawthorne | H | 1,510 Sq Ft | $1,950 |
| Heritage Hill | Heritage Dr Townhome | 1,475 Sq Ft | $1,825 |
| The Banks Student Living | 3x3 A | 1,122 Sq Ft | $799 |
